Bangalore: LearnVest, an operator of a personal finance website for women, has raised $4.5 million in Series A funding. Accel Partners led the round, and was joined by seed backers Richmond Management, Rose Tech Ventures and members of Circle Financial Group. LearnVest plans to use the funding to meet the strong demand for its current trusted information and tools, expand on its offerings, and build on the company's recent success. LearnVest is the independent personal finance website targeting the 70 million women who control over 80 percent of all consumer spending in the United States. Through LearnVest.com, LearnVest provides trusted content and tools to help women tackle their finances at each stage of life. These tools include Financial Checklists, a customized Action Plan, a Budgeting Tool, a 20-day Financial Resolution Bootcamp, and carefully vetted recommendations to help users find the financial accounts they need. LearnVest educates subscribers via the "LearnVest Daily," a bite-size email guide of hip lifestyle tips for living on a budget. LearnVest was first conceptualized by Alexa von Tobel in 2006, as she graduated from college.
